A 23-year-old male driver was arrested in Kowloon Bay when a private car was reversing and crashed into a police motorcycle.

Sau Mau Ping Police District Assistant Commander (Criminal) Acting Superintendent Ma Lianhao explained the case, saying that at about 11 pm on November 14 this year, a traffic policeman driving a motorcycle on Kai Cheung Road in Kowloon Bay found an illegal vehicle when patrolling Kai Cheung Road. In private cars, the driver uses his mobile phone while driving.

The traffic police asked the driver to stop, but he did not follow the instructions and crashed into the police motorcycle and speeded up to escape.


The Police Crime Squad took over the investigation and identified the driver of the private car involved. The detectives arrested the 23-year-old man surnamed Huang in Shuomen Village, Shatian District yesterday (29th) morning and seized a small amount of cocaine in the vehicle involved.

The arrested man was charged with 9 crimes, including suspected dangerous driving, driving without a valid driver's license, using the vehicle without third party insurance, failing to park according to police instructions, failing to park after the accident, failing to report after the accident, and using mobile while driving Telephone, drug trafficking and criminal damage.

According to the police, the arrested man pleaded guilty to other crimes except drug trafficking, and he is still being detained for investigation.

As for a 37-year-old man surnamed Chen arrested in a unit in On Yam Village, Kwai Chung earlier, he was the owner of the private car in the case and was suspected of failing to provide police officers with details.

He has been released on bail pending further investigation and must report to the police in late December.

On the night of the 14th of this month, a private car hit an iron cavalry patrol in Kowloon Bay.

At that time, when the traffic police patrolled Kai Cheung Road in the direction of Kai Tak, they found a male driver of a driving private car talking on the phone and asked him to stop by the road. However, the other party did not follow the instructions and ran away. The motorcycle catches up from behind.

When the two cars came to a stop at a red light, the officer got out of the car and went forward to understand that the private car suddenly faded, knocked down the police motorcycle and accelerated away.
